Caerphilly to Stratford (London) by train

A train trip from Caerphilly to Stratford (London) takes about 3hrs 13 mins on average, covering roughly 138 miles (222 kilometres). With around 28 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£27.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Caerphilly to Stratford (London) start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Caerphilly to Stratford (London) start from £102.50 one way, or £103.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Caerphilly to Stratford (London) are available for £149.50 one way, or £299.00 return

Getting your journey underway is straightforward at Caerphilly Train Station. With opening hours from Monday to Saturday, the ticket office ensures you can purchase and collect tickets with ease. Additionally, ticket machines are available, offering accessibility to those who prefer to use debit or credit cards. For frequent travelers, smartcard validation is right at the station, although smartcards themselves are not issued here.

Your Needs Covered: Facilities and Amenities

Caerphilly Train Station is equipped with an induction loop, making it easier for hearing aid users to access travel information. While there aren't any waiting rooms, seating areas are present for your comfort. Safety is a priority too, with CCTV monitoring, though there isn't a provision for luggage storage or dedicated staff for assistance.

For accessibility, step-free access is available on Platform 1, suitable for those heading to Cardiff. However, Platform 2 involves a footbridge or steep ramp, which may be challenging. There are no accessible toilets, but ramps are available for train access, ensuring an accommodating experience for all travelers.

Onward Travel Options

Whether commuting or exploring, connecting to your next destination from Caerphilly Train Station is convenient. Rail replacement services are at Bay 11, and taxis are readily available within 100 meters of the station. If you prefer buses, Stagecoach offers regular services to nearby areas, and purchasing a Caerphilly PlusBus ticket can enhance your journey with unlimited bus travel. The bus interchange is conveniently located beside the rail station, making your transition between modes of transport seamless.

Amenities and Facilities at Stratford (London)

Stratford (London) station is equipped with a variety of amenities designed to comfort and convenience. The station's ticket office is open from 6:15 AM to 9:30 PM during the week,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ets at your convenience, no matter when your travels commence. Accessible ticket machines and smartcard validators make purchasing tickets straightforward, even on the busiest days.

For those seeking information or assistance, staff is readily available at help points, the ticket office, and dedicated information points. Featuring step-free access and induction loops, the station ensures that everyone can travel with ease. Whether you require accessible toilets, baby changing facilities, or simply a place to sit while waiting for your train, the station accommodates your needs. Have a look at the TfL Lost Property page should you misplace something during your visit.

Onwards from Stratford

With convenient transport links at its doorstep, Stratford Station is a gateway to a variety of travel options. Rail replacement services ensure that travel plans are seamless, even during disruptions. On Great Eastern Road, the taxi rank makes for an easy exit to your next adventure, be it business or leisure. A plethora of bus services operates just outside the station, ready to whisk you away into London’s vast expanse. If the underground tickles your fancy, the Central and Jubilee Lines, along with Docklands Light Railway, are at your service.

Planning a getaway can even include airports, with connections via the Elizabeth Line to Heathrow, DLR to London City Airport, or Greater Anglia to Stansted Airport. All these options combine to make Stratford (London) an ideal starting point for both domestic and international travel.
